Sarah Vaughan - Trees(2012 Remastered)

I think that I shall never see

A poem lovely as a tree

A tree whose hungry mouth is pressed

Against the Earth's sweet flowing breast

A tree that looks at God all day

And lifts her leafy

Lifts her leafy arms to pray

A tree that may in Summer wear

A nest A nest of robins in her hair

Upon whose bosom snow has lain

Who intimately lives with rain

Poems are made by fools like me

But only God can make a tree
